可控制性的隐藏前端页面导航菜单的方法-navlist方法修改

楼主

有些项目有可能会有这样的要求“指定某个栏目不在主导航菜单显示,但是这个不显示的栏目会在别的页面调用”针对这样的要求此程序我本人暂没有发现有特别好用的方法,有可能你们会用If判断来过滤,但我觉得这不是个好方法,毕竟后期栏目如果有所变动,可能就不能实现了(栏目增,删导致栏目Id的改变)。于是本人做了大胆的尝试,修改如下:

1,修改Yang.class.php


2,修改function.php3,category表里增加“ismenu”字段,当然这个字段随便写,只要跟程序里调用的对应就行



4.修改Category_add.html和Category_edit.html(这两个是后台文件),增加如下


此时此刻,大功告成

此方法为个人琢磨出来的,可能不够完美,大家如果觉得有问题,可以自行修改,同时也建议官方能完善此功能

09月23日 11:41 回复(2) 点赞 
共 2 条记录
回复